The contract requires compliance with NAVSEA 5100-003D for the handling, labeling, and documentation of mercury-containing components when applicable to the item or its packaging. All activities must adhere to strict hazardous materials protocols to ensure safety and regulatory adherence throughout the supply chain. The work is classified as a subcontract under NAICS code 562910, indicating a focus on waste treatment and disposal services, and is managed by the Department of Defense through its Land Supply Chain office. Performance is designated for Chesapeake, Virginia, with a zip code of 23320, and all submissions must be completed by the response deadline of July 27, 2026. The solicitation was posted on July 14, 2026, and participants must ensure their processes align with military hazardous materials standards to meet contractual obligations.

Radioactive Materials Notification and Handling (If Applicable)This contract requires advance notification and detailed technical reporting for any items containing radioactive material that exceed specified regulatory thresholds, as mandated by DFARS clause 252.223-7002. The obligation applies to subcontractors who may supply components, equipment, or materials that contain radioactive substances, ensuring full compliance with federal safety and reporting standards. All parties must provide timely documentation outlining the type, quantity, and location of radioactive content prior to delivery or integration, with technical data sufficient to support regulatory review and risk assessment. The requirement is triggered only when thresholds are met, but failure to report or misrepresentation can result in contract noncompliance and potential penalties. The contract is issued under solicitation by the ASC Commodities Division of the Department of Defense, with performance centered at New Cumberland, Pennsylvania, zip code 17070-5002. It is classified under NAICS code 562910, indicating its linkage to waste treatment and remediation services, though the actual deliverables focus on supply chain transparency for radioactive materials. Subcontractors must respond by July 22, 2026, with submissions processed through the DIBBS system. While no set-aside status is designated, all respondents must be prepared to demonstrate adherence to nuclear materials handling protocols and provide verifiable evidence of compliance with NRC, DOT, and other applicable federal regulations governing radioactive content in defense-related supplies.
